An ASIA reverse from Asia Minor
Lot 3099
Hadrian, 117-138. Denarius (Silver, 19 mm, 3.09 g, 6 h), uncertain mint in the East, circa 130-135. HADRIANVS AVG COS III P P Laureate head of Hadrian to right, with slight drapery on his left shoulder. Rev. ASIA Asia standing front, head to left, her right foot set on prow, holding hook in her right hand and rudder in her left. BMC -. RIC -, cf. 3168 (differing bust type). Strack -. An extremely rare variety. Attractive iridescent toning. Very light marks, otherwise, very fine.

From the collection of Eric ten Brink, ex Noonans 253, 13 April 2022, 1442 and from the Percy Webb Collection, Vecchi 5, 5 March 1997, 534 (with original ticket).

The 'ASIA' reverse is particularly appropriate for this series of eastern denarii struck in Asia Minor.
